Your go-to source for towing insights and news.
Discover the epic showdown of browsers fighting for your compatibility! Uncover the secrets behind seamless web experiences.
In the ever-evolving landscape of web development, browser compatibility is a crucial factor that developers and businesses must consider. As users access websites through various browsers like Chrome, Firefox, Safari, and more, inconsistencies in how these browsers render web pages can lead to a fragmented user experience. A site that looks perfect on one browser may appear broken or dysfunctional on another, ultimately affecting user engagement and retention. Thus, understanding the nuances of browser compatibility is paramount in ensuring that your website delivers a seamless experience across multiple platforms.
Moreover, the impact of browser compatibility extends beyond just aesthetics; it encompasses functionality and performance as well. For example, certain features may be supported in one browser but not in others, which can lead to lost opportunities for conversions or user interactions. To mitigate these risks, developers often employ testing strategies, using tools and frameworks that aid in identifying compatibility issues early on. By prioritizing browser compatibility, businesses can ensure that they not only attract a wider audience but also provide a consistent, reliable, and engaging web experience.
The evolution of web standards has transformed the way we interact with the internet, shaping browsers into powerful tools that deliver a seamless user experience. From the early days of web development, when HTML was the primary language, to the introduction of CSS and JavaScript, browsers have continually adapted to support new technologies. This journey began with the inception of HTML, which laid the groundwork for content creation, but over time, the demand for more dynamic and interactive web pages led to the implementation of standards such as HTML5 and CSS3. As these standards emerged, they prompted browser developers to innovate, leading to the creation of modern features like responsive design and multimedia integration.
As we look back on this browser's journey, it's evident that the development of web standards has been crucial in ensuring compatibility and accessibility across different platforms. The establishment of organizations such as the World Wide Web Consortium (W3C) has played a pivotal role in promoting these standards, enabling browsers to interpret and render web pages consistently. Today, as we witness the rise of technologies such as Progressive Web Apps (PWAs) and the increasing significance of web accessibility, it is clear that the evolution of web standards is far from over. Browsers continue to evolve, integrating new standards that not only enhance user experience but also prioritize security and performance in an ever-changing digital landscape.
Different web browsers, such as Chrome, Firefox, Safari, and Edge, have their own rendering engines that interpret HTML, CSS, and JavaScript. These engines play a critical role in how websites are displayed and executed. For instance, Chrome uses the Blink engine, while Firefox relies on Gecko. Each browser may implement the latest web standards differently, which can lead to variations in how a website appears or functions across platforms. Key factors that affect rendering include:
In addition to rendering, performance can also vary significantly between browsers when executing JavaScript. For example, some browsers optimize the execution of JavaScript through Just-In-Time (JIT) compilation, while others may rely on different optimization techniques. This can impact how quickly scripts run and how interactive a webpage feels to the user. Developers often need to test their websites in multiple browsers to ensure consistently smooth performance and appearance. Additionally, issues such as CSS layout differences and HTML parsing inconsistencies can arise, which makes cross-browser compatibility testing an essential step in the web development process.